CI Note: Validator plugin loading failures on Corvuspipe. New team members: the data-validator plugin system resolves plugins at build time from the internal registry, and CI fails if a plugin's declared schema version trails the core by more than one minor release. Check the resolver log step first — a stale lockfile is the usual culprit. Regenerate it and rerun. The failing job's trace token appears below.

pipeline stamp: htk9_ce63042d9

// MAX_CONCURRENT_CHECKOUTS caps the number of simultaneous synthetic
// checkout sessions the Varnhollow load harness will open against the
// staging gateway. Raising this without coordinating with the payments
// team will exhaust the sandbox token pool and skew latency numbers.
// The value was calibrated during the Q3 soak test, whose run is
// identified by the token recorded below.

session token of kageg-tahop = htk14_af3c1ccccb7dcf

FAQ: Fire-drill roll call. During drills at Branmoor Court, the facilities desk prints the attendance roster from the Tallygate system and takes it to assembly point two by the courtyard. The roster terminal sits in the back office and stays locked between drills. To unlock the terminal, enter the code below.

door code, yagap-bahof: bdg-O-05

## Authentication

Heads up: the nightly reindex job (`reindex_nightly.py`) talks to the Lanternfish search cluster, and that cluster won't accept anonymous writes anymore — we locked it down last sprint. The job now authenticates as the `reindex-runner` service identity against Corvid Gateway, and the token is injected via the `LF_INDEX_TOKEN` env var in the scheduler config. Nothing clever going on, just a bearer header on every batch request. For review purposes, the staging credential currently in use is listed below.

service key, kadug-kadup: kto15_rN23XLAYImmZgrJ